About Aikshul

Aikshul is a language isolate spoken by people in a world maybe

Grammatical features:
  • SOV word order
  • 6 degrees of noun animacy
  • Split-ergativity based on animacy
  • 7 noun cases (unmarked, ergative, accusative, dative, genitive, prepositional, partitive)

    Phonology
    ConsonantsBilabialLabio-
    dental
    AlveolarRetroflexPalatalLabio-
    velar
    VelarPharyngeal
    Nasal m   n       [ŋ]1  
    Plosive p pʰ [b]2   t tʰ [d]3       k kʰ [g]4  
    Fricative   f s z ʂ [ç]5 [ʝ]6   x ɣ [ʕ]7
    Lateral approximant     l   [ʎ]8      
    Approximant   ʋ     j [w]9 [ɰ]10  
    Flap     ɾ          
    1. before velars, allophone of /n/
    2. after vowels, allophone of /p/
    3. after vowels, allophone of /t/
    4. after vowels, allophone of /k/
    5. palatalised, allophone of /x/
    6. palatalised, allophone of /ɣ/
    7. word-finally, allophone of /x/
    8. after nasals, allophone of /j/
    9. word-initially, allophone of /ʋ/
    10. after vowels, allophone of /ɣ/
    VowelsFrontBack
    Close i i: u u:
    Close-mid e o
    Open a a:  
    Polyphthongs ɔu̯ ɛi̯ oi̯ ai̯ au̯
